Congrats on your first 30 days! I hate to break it to you, but there is nothing "magic" about it. It's a convenient marker for a milestone, that's all. A way to measure how far you have come. There is a lot of work ahead of you if you are to stay happily sober for the long haul.

It's a nice thing to have, and I'm not trying to diminish it in any way, shape, or form. Everybody with 10, or 20, or 30 years started with 30 days, and before that, with one day. The days add up!
